The NOC Engineer role focuses on building, implementing, and maintaining edge routing infrastructure. You'll act as a bridge between the Network Engineering, Systems Engineering, and Operations teams. A key part of the job is providing first-level customer network support and monitoring infrastructure to proactively troubleshoot issues. You'll work closely with Network Engineers and Data Center Technicians to implement connectivity solutions and resolve network-related problems. This role requires the ability to work independently with little to no direct supervision.
Key Responsibilities
- Manage customer connections: Onboard new physical and logical connections and decommission canceled ones.
- Ensure market access: Certify that latency is equalized for all customer connections.
- Provide customer support: Answer the NOC phone line and respond to support tickets.
- Communicate with customers: Provide timely and professional updates on project timelines and maintenance.
- Participate in on-call rotation: Be available to support network operations outside of normal business hours.
- Monitor during trading hours: Proactively monitor customer and market center connectivity and engage with customers if issues arise.
- Support weekend testing: Participate in internal and industry-wide weekend testing as needed.
Job Requirements
- CCNA, CCNP, Network+ or equivalent experience
- Subnetting
- ACL configuration and troubleshooting
- BGP configuration and troubleshooting including route filtering
- PIM/IGMP multicast configuration and troubleshooting
- Packet capture experience
- tcpdump and similar tools for data capture
- Wireshark for data capture and analysis
- TCP troubleshooting
- Infrastructure as Code and Network Automation experience is helpful but not required
- Python
- Terraform
- Ansible
- Git
- Linux shell scripting
